  2. I started out on 3/8 with a bid of $50 for a 4-Star i the Downtown area. It was rejected. On 3/9 (though not 24 hrs later) I added an area of San Diego with no 4-stars (Point Loma-Shelter Island-Old Town) to my Downtown-Harbor Island search and raised the bid to $56. It was rejected - however with the rejection it told me that if I was willing to raise my bid by $17 I would be able to search again immediately. I've never had this offered to me before so I figured I would give it a shot. The bid for $73 was accepted! This was all linked through the PRICELINE link on this website, of course :) One thing that I noticed was that the $5 trip insurance was added to my bill and I don't recall selecting it. I noticed the offer the first time I bid on 3/8 but not on 3/9. It's not a huge deal but I probably wouldn't have spend the $5 on it. So that, the room taxes and such brings my total for $95.28. I can live with that :)
  3. I booked this hotel yesterday, Thursday, September 17th around 3pm. My first bid was for $50 and it was immediately accepted (which always makes me think I should have tried lower) They booked us at the Hyatt Regency and the total with taxes and fees was $63.92 Other information.... When I logged into the Hyatt site it showed that they had us booked into a King room, which normally is my preference but there is a chance we will have our kids with us so two beds would work better. I realize that they only garuntee double occupancy through PRICELINE but I thought I would check with the hotel. When I called the hotel, they identified that I had booked through Priceline (not in a negative way, just stated it) and when I put in the request for two beds she said she would make a note of it and to ask when I checked in. She also put in for a roll-away bed just in case they weren't able to make the switch (very helpful and nice). Nothing was said about an additional fee so I guess we'll see what happens when we check in this afternoon!
